There’s something I’ve been noticing more and more… not just around me, but in the way people are feeling lately.
There’s a sense of uncertainty.
Things are going up.
The conversations around us are filled with worry.
Everywhere you look, something is being said about what’s going wrong, what might happen, what we need to be afraid of.
And even if you try not to focus on it… it still finds a way in.
Quietly.
Into your thoughts.
Into your body.
Into the way you start to anticipate life.
But if you really sit with it… this isn’t new.
This pattern has been there for years.
Prices go up.
Situations change.
The narrative shifts slightly… but the feeling stays the same.
Fear.
And what’s interesting is… even though we’ve seen this pattern repeat over and over again…
we still get pulled into it, as though it’s something completely new.
And this is where something deeper comes in.
Because life, in many ways, moves in patterns.
But the way we experience those patterns… is shaped by what we believe.
By the lens we’re looking through.
Because at the same time that things are “getting harder”…
people are still living.
Still being provided for.
Still moving forward.
And that’s not by coincidence.
That’s because provision has never been tied to what’s happening outside.
It’s always been tied to the One who controls it.
Allah
And this is where belief becomes everything.
Because what you expect… quietly shapes what you experience.
If your expectation is rooted in fear…
then everything around you will confirm that fear.
But if your expectation is rooted in knowing that Allah is in control… that provision comes from Him… that what is written for you will reach you…
then something within you begins to settle.
Not because circumstances have suddenly changed…
but because your relationship with them has.
And at the same time… we also have to be honest about something.
Sometimes it’s not as simple as “just believe.”
Because for many of us, the fear we feel is not just about what’s happening now.
It’s connected to what we’ve carried.
Old experiences.
Old beliefs.
Things we’ve internalised over time.
And that’s why even when we know the truth… we still feel the anxiety.
We still feel the overwhelm.
And that’s where the deeper work comes in.
Not just shifting what you think…
but understanding what’s sitting underneath it.
Because when you begin to work through that… when you begin to process what you’ve been holding… when you start to become aware of your patterns…
something changes.
You’re no longer reacting in the same way.
You’re no longer pulled into every wave of fear.
You begin to feel… steadier.
More grounded.
More able to return to trust.
